Summary

TLDRIn this video script, the teacher outlines the process of introducing the present continuous tense through board work. By engaging students in interactive discussion, they will analyze example sentences to identify the structure of the tense: subject + verb 'be' + verb-ing. The teacher aims to elicit from the students the common features of words in the sentences, such as the subjects and verb forms, encouraging them to recognize patterns in the tense. This methodical approach is designed to make the tense clear and engaging for learners within a ten-minute timeframe.

Takeaways

  • 😀 The first part of the study phase involves board work, using information from the elicitation part of the engage phase.
  • 😀 The purpose of the study phase is to show the structure of a particular tense.
  • 😀 The study phase is expected to take about ten minutes, and it involves interaction with students.
  • 😀 The focus of the board work is on eliciting the structure of the present continuous tense.
  • 😀 Students are asked to analyze sentences and identify common features in the first words.
  • 😀 The first words in the sentences are likely to be the subjects, which students can identify during the activity.
  • 😀 Once subjects are identified, the next step is to look at the second word, which will be 'am', 'is', or 'are' in the present continuous tense.
  • 😀 The second word is the verb 'to be', and students are expected to recognize its pattern.
  • 😀 The third word in each sentence is a verb ending with 'ing', which is a key feature of the present continuous tense.
  • 😀 The overall structure of the present continuous tense is: subject + verb 'to be' (am, is, are) + verb + 'ing'.

Q & A

  • What is the main focus of the first part of the study phase?

    -The main focus of the first part of the study phase is the board work, where the teacher will use the information generated in the elicitation phase to show the structure of a specific tense.

  • How long is the expected duration of the study phase in this lesson?

    -The expected duration of the study phase is about ten minutes.

  • Who will do most of the talking during the study phase?

    -The students will do most of the talking during the study phase, with the teacher facilitating the interaction.

  • How will the teacher use the sentences to help the students understand the tense structure?

    -The teacher will ask the students to look at the sentences and identify commonalities, such as the subject, the verb form, and the ending 'ing' on the verbs, to help them deduce the structure of the present continuous tense.

  • What is the first element that the students should identify in the sentences?

    -The first element that students should identify is the subject of each sentence.

  • What subjects are already provided in the sentences, and which ones should be elicited?

    -The provided subjects are likely pronouns like 'I,' 'you,' and 'he.' The teacher should elicit other subjects like 'we' and 'it.'

  • What is the second element that the students should identify in the sentences?

    -The second element is the verb form, specifically 'am,' 'is,' or 'are,' which are forms of the verb 'to be.'

  • What is the third element that the students should identify in the sentences?

    -The third element is the verb ending in 'ing,' which follows the verb 'to be' in the present continuous tense.

  • How will the teacher highlight the structure of the present continuous tense?

    -The teacher will highlight the structure of the present continuous tense by showing the pattern: subject + verb 'to be' (am, is, are) + verb + 'ing'.

  • What role does spelling play in understanding the verb form in the sentences?

    -Spelling plays a minor role, as the primary focus is on the 'ing' ending of the verbs, although there may be slight variations in spelling for some verbs.
